日本黄色一级经典视频|伊人久久精品视频|亚洲黄色色周成人视频九九九|av免费网址黄色小短片|黄色Av无码亚洲成年人|亚洲1区2区3区无码|真人黄片免费观看|无码一级小说欧美日免费三级|日韩中文字幕91在线看|精品久久久无码中文字幕边打电话

當(dāng)前位置:首頁 > 芯聞號 > 充電吧
[導(dǎo)讀]朱有鵬嵌入式核心課程路線圖 整個學(xué)習(xí)路線圖很龐大,為了描述簡單我把目錄分成了幾個層次,分層瀏覽。 第一層目錄: 0.基礎(chǔ)預(yù)科 1.ARM裸機全集 2.uboot和linux內(nèi)核移植 3.linux驅(qū)動

朱有鵬嵌入式核心課程路線圖
整個學(xué)習(xí)路線圖很龐大,為了描述簡單我把目錄分成了幾個層次,分層瀏覽。
第一層目錄:
0.基礎(chǔ)預(yù)科
1.ARM裸機全集
2.uboot和linux內(nèi)核移植
3.linux驅(qū)動開發(fā)
4.C語言專題精講篇
5.linux應(yīng)用編程和網(wǎng)絡(luò)編程
6.階段項目篇


說明:第一層目錄中共有6個部分,共同構(gòu)成了嵌入式核心課程。每個部分下面又會分為若干模塊,以此來構(gòu)建出整個知識體系網(wǎng)絡(luò)。


第二層目錄:
0.基礎(chǔ)預(yù)科
? ? 0.1.嵌入式軟件工程師完全學(xué)習(xí)指南
? ? 0.2.朱老師帶你零基礎(chǔ)學(xué)Linux
? ? 0.3.嵌入式linux C編程基礎(chǔ)


1.ARM裸機全集
? ? 1.1.ARM裸機第一部分-ARM那些你得知道的事兒
? ? 1.2.ARM裸機第二部分-ARM體系結(jié)構(gòu)與匯編指令
? ? 1.3.ARM裸機第三部分-開發(fā)板、原理圖和數(shù)據(jù)手冊
? ? 1.4.ARM裸機第四部分-GPIO和LED
? ? 1.5.ARM裸機第五部分-SDRAM和重定位relocate
? ? 1.6.ARM裸機第六部分-時鐘系統(tǒng)
? ? 1.7.ARM裸機第七部分-串口通信詳解
? ? 1.8.ARM裸機第八部分-按鍵和CPU的中斷系統(tǒng)
? ? 1.9.ARM裸機第九部分-定時器、看門狗和RTC
? ? 1.10.ARM裸機第十部分-PWM和蜂鳴器
? ? 1.11.ARM裸機第十一部分-I2C通信詳解
? ? 1.12.ARM裸機第十二部分-NandFlash和文件系統(tǒng)
? ? 1.13.ARM裸機第十三部分-ADC
? ? 1.14.ARM裸機第十四部分-LCD顯示器
? ? 1.15.ARM裸機第十五部分-觸摸屏TouchScreen
? ? 1.16.ARM裸機第十六部分-shell原理和問答機制引入


2.uboot和linux內(nèi)核移植
? ? 2.1.U-Boot學(xué)習(xí)前傳
? ? 2.2.補基礎(chǔ)之shell和Makefile
? ? 2.3.零距離初體驗U-Boot
? ? 2.4.U-Boot配置和編譯過程詳解
? ? 2.5.U-Boot源碼分析1-啟動第一階段
? ? 2.6.U-Boot源碼分析2-啟動第二階段
? ? 2.7.U-Boot源碼分析3-啟動內(nèi)核
? ? 2.8.U-Boot源碼分析4-命令體系
? ? 2.9.U-Boot源碼分析5-環(huán)境變量
? ? 2.10.U-Boot源碼分析6-硬件驅(qū)動
? ? 2.11.U-Boot移植1-三星官方
? ? 2.12.U-Boot移植2-官方標(biāo)準(zhǔn)移植
? ? 2.13.Logo顯示和Fastboot原理
? ? 2.14.話說Linux內(nèi)核
? ? 2.15.內(nèi)核的配置和編譯原理
? ? 2.16.內(nèi)核的啟動過程分析
? ? 2.17.從三星官方內(nèi)核開始移植
? ? 2.18.根文件系統(tǒng)的原理
? ? 2.19.根文件系統(tǒng)構(gòu)建實驗及過程詳解
? ? 2.20.buildroot的引入和介紹


3.linux應(yīng)用編程和網(wǎng)絡(luò)編程
? ? 3.1.Linux中的文件IO
? ? 3.2.文件屬性
? ? 3.3.獲取系統(tǒng)信息
? ? 3.4.Linux進程全解
? ? 3.5.Linux中的信號
? ? 3.6.高級IO
? ? 3.7.Linux線程全解
? ? 3.8.linux網(wǎng)絡(luò)編程基礎(chǔ)
? ? 3.9.linux網(wǎng)絡(luò)編程實踐


4.C語言專題精講篇
? ? 4.1.內(nèi)存這個大話題
? ? 4.2.C語言位操作
? ? 4.3.指針才是C的精髓
? ? 4.4.C語言復(fù)雜表達式與指針高級應(yīng)用
? ? 4.5.數(shù)組&字符串&結(jié)構(gòu)體&共用體&枚舉
? ? 4.6.C語言宏定義與預(yù)處理、函數(shù)和函數(shù)庫
? ? 4.7.存儲類&作用域&生命周期&鏈接屬性
? ? 4.8.一些雜散但值得討論的問題
? ? 4.9.鏈表&狀態(tài)機與多線程
? ? 4.10.番外篇-程序員和編譯器之間的曖昧

5.Linux驅(qū)動開發(fā)
? ? 5.1.驅(qū)動應(yīng)該怎么學(xué)
? ? 5.2.字符設(shè)備驅(qū)動基礎(chǔ)
? ? 5.3.字符設(shè)備驅(qū)動高級
? ? 5.4.驅(qū)動框架入門之LED
? ? 5.5.Linux設(shè)備驅(qū)動模型
? ? 5.6.Misc類設(shè)備與蜂鳴器驅(qū)動
? ? 5.7.Framebuffer驅(qū)動詳解
? ? 5.8.input子系統(tǒng)基礎(chǔ)之按鍵
? ? 5.9.I2C總線和觸摸屏驅(qū)動移植實戰(zhàn)
? ? 5.10.塊設(shè)備驅(qū)動介紹
? ? 5.11.網(wǎng)絡(luò)設(shè)備驅(qū)動介紹

6.階段項目篇
? ? 6.小項目.圖片解碼播放器視頻課程
本站聲明: 本文章由作者或相關(guān)機構(gòu)授權(quán)發(fā)布,目的在于傳遞更多信息,并不代表本站贊同其觀點,本站亦不保證或承諾內(nèi)容真實性等。需要轉(zhuǎn)載請聯(lián)系該專欄作者,如若文章內(nèi)容侵犯您的權(quán)益,請及時聯(lián)系本站刪除( 郵箱:macysun@21ic.com )。
換一批
延伸閱讀
關(guān)閉